What I Check Before Buying
Before I buy any silicone mold 3D train, I always look at a few important things. First, I check the size to make sure it fits my project. Then I look at the design details, because a good mold should show clear train features like wheels, windows, and engine shape. I also pay attention to whether the mold is food-safe if I plan to use it for baking or chocolate.
Material Quality Matters
My experience has taught me that not all silicone molds are the same. I prefer molds made from high-quality, BPA-free, food-grade silicone when I need them for edible items. A thicker mold usually feels more durable and lasts longer. If the silicone feels too thin or flimsy, I worry it may tear or lose shape over time.
Ease of Release
One of the main reasons I use silicone molds is how easily they release the finished item. With a 3D train mold, I want the shape to come out cleanly without sticking. I usually look for molds with a smooth inner surface and enough flexibility to bend gently when removing the train figure.
Detail and Finish
I always prefer molds that capture fine details well. A train mold with crisp edges and clear patterns makes the final result look more realistic and attractive. If I’m using it for decoration, presentation matters a lot. A mold with poor detailing can make the finished train look flat or messy.
Heat and Cold Resistance
If I plan to use the mold for baking, I make sure it can handle oven temperatures safely. For chocolate, soap, or resin, I still check the temperature resistance so I know it won’t warp or crack. Good silicone molds should handle both hot and cold conditions depending on the material and intended use.
Cleaning and Maintenance
I like molds that are easy to clean because it saves me time. Dishwasher-safe molds are especially convenient, but I still usually wash them gently by hand to keep them in good shape. I also make sure the mold dries completely before storing it, so it stays clean and odor-free.
